Hurricane season should be cranking up over the next several weeks. Let’s hope the big storms miss us, but the reality is somebody is going to get hit, and if it’s an area with vulnerable homes there will be millions if not billions of dollars in damage. As Professor Joseph Barbera said in?The Last House Standing, HOPE is not a strategy.
